摘要:A novel and economical process for mechanochemical organic synthesis by ball milling performed in rotary evaporator is described. The process parameters, such as molar ratio and feeding amount of reactant, rotation frequency, as well as the number, diameter and material of the milling balls, were investigated in a model reaction. Other four test reactions were then performed using this process. The results indicated that the ball milling in rotary evaporator is practical.
